Losing to the Lions pretty much sealed it for GB. Not that I don't expect the Lions to lose at least 2 more games, because let's face it, as badly as GB was beaten on Thanksgiving, Josh Sittons remarks weren't false in anyway.

They are the Lions, they are incredibly talented and incredibly poorly coached, undisciplined, and will find a way to lose a few games when they matter. About the only reason they will most likely win the division is because nobody else seems to want to step up and take it this year. They'll try and give it away, but I don't know if there are enough games left at this point.

If Rodgers is healthy, he should play. If he isn't, he shouldn't. I don't believe you ever play for a draft pick, unless you are a fucking loser. At the same time there isn't any reason to rush him back if there's no post season to play for either.

I'm not sure this GB team can come back this year even with Rodgers. Their offensive line, like usual is fucking horrible. They look semi passable because Rodgers makes them look that way. he has a very smooth and uncanny way of avoiding the rush to give himself a bit more time to find an open receiver and he's incredibly accurate when throwing on the move. His presence also opens up the running game because other than Sitton, our offensive line can't seem to move in any direction but backwards in the face of a defensive player.

Beyond that, I think our defense is gassed and beat down. They certainly have looked it the past couple weeks. They've spent a lot of time on the field, and they certainly haven't helped themselves out much in that regard, but it looks to be snowballing on them now. And the same problems that have plagued them for a couple seasons are still there. They all seem to be playing different schemes within the same play and still they don't have the players coached up, or the playbook dumbed down.
